avcodec/x86/hpeldsp_init: Remove MMX(EXT) funcs overridden by SSE2

This affects the {avg,put}_no_rnd_pixels16_{x,y}2 MMX and
(put-only) MMXEXT versions. Removing these functions saved
1184B here.
